Job Description

We are currently seeking a dedicated Safety, Health & Environment (SH&E) Advisor to join our dynamic team in Abu Dhabi. This role is essential in supporting compliance with local SH&E regulations, AECOM standards, and project-specific safety policies. The SH&E Advisor will conduct daily site inspections, monitor risks, and foster a culture of safety excellence throughout our projects.


Key Responsibilities

  • Serve as the on-site SH&E point of contact for all safety-related matters

  • Conduct daily inspections and report safety issues and observations

  • Ensure contractor compliance with SH&E policies, plans, and legislative obligations

  • Review and assess risk mitigation documents, including SWMS and risk assessments

  • Participate in and, if needed, chair site SH&E meetings

  • Monitor site security, fire safety, first aid, and welfare facilities

  • Investigate incidents and near misses, identify preventative measures, and ensure follow-through

  • Report SH&E metrics and provide regular updates to Project and SH&E Leads

  • Attend relevant SH&E training and maintain professional competency

  • Promote a proactive safety culture by setting a strong personal example


Requirements

  • Diploma in Engineering, Occupational Safety, or related discipline

  • NEBOSH General Certificate or equivalent safety qualification

  • Minimum 5 years of experience in safety management within construction or infrastructure projects

  • Strong understanding of UAE SH&E regulations and compliance requirements

  • Excellent communication and coordination skills

  • Experience conducting risk assessments and investigations

  • Ability to influence and support safety awareness across teams
